Mastering eLearning Localization

eLearning content is becoming increasingly popular globally. To maximize its impact and resonate with a wider audience, it's essential to localize your products.

Localization involves modifying your eLearning content to suit the cultural, linguistic, and regional needs of your target audience. This includes more than just converting text.

It also requires consideration of image-based elements, voiceover, and even the overall design of your eLearning platform.

A well-localized eLearning solution can increase learner participation, improve understanding, and ultimately lead to improved learning outcomes.

To achieve successful eLearning localization, consider these key steps:

* Conduct a thorough needs analysis to identify your target audiences' cultural and linguistic requirements.

* Select qualified translators and localization specialists who understand the nuances of both the source and target cultures.

* Employ a consistent style guide and glossary to maintain accuracy and brand image across all localized materials.

* Test and validate your localized content thoroughly to ensure it is clear, concise, and culturally suitable.

* Continuously monitor and adjust your localization efforts based on learner feedback and evolving more info market trends.

By following these best practices, you can create a truly global eLearning experience that empowers learners worldwide.
